NES Fircroft is recruiting a Synthetic Organic Chemist to join a leading agricultural company. This role is based at our client's site in Bracknell on a 12 month contract.

As a Synthetic Organic Chemist, you will have the opportunity to work in multi-disciplinary projects in the field of Agrochemistry, towards the creation of next generation weed control products.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Design safe, sustainable, and effective synthetic routes
  • Execute synthesis
  • Develop creative solutions to complex synthetic challenges.
  • Maintain excellence in modern synthetic methods
  • Proactively improve laboratory safety, efficiency, and workflows.

Qualifications:
  • Hold a PhD in Organic Chemistry or a closely related discipline
  • Experience in industry
  • a good understanding of process chemistry and scale up
  • Able to summarise and present scientific results
